I have some general questions regarding how many file system mounts one
could reasonably make on a system (assume lots of CPU and RAM for the
sake of argument). So in a general sense:

1. Is there a hard limit?
2. Do the type(s) of the mount(s) matter?
3. Does mounting in jails matter vs. mounting directly on the host?
4. And the $64 question, if I had a setup with lots of jails, and each
had a nullfs, devfs, and 2 or 3 NFS mounts, how many jails could I have
without causing an implosion? :)
